every time i start a game i get disconnected with the error "disconnected from host, error code 500". It happens with both killers and survivors and happens during loading. it is the windows version and i bought it, i tried to reinstall the game, to check the files, to change dns and also connection. I reinstalled the xbox app and reset both the xbox app and the microsoft store multiple times, I also used the windows "troubleshooter" tool. I don't know what to do anymore, I just have to format the computer. I wrote to support but it will take a while for them to respond.

    I managed to fix the bug alone.

    I have two xbox accounts, on one I bought dbd and on the other I had the pass. I entered with what dbd had bought but the game took the account with the pass as its primary account and consequently it didn't let me play because it was as if I didn't have the game. To solve you have to go to emai and account, in the settings, and remove one of the two accounts so that there are no conflicts.

    I have been dealing with this issue, and have been in contact with DBD support. After performing all the troubleshooting methods with the support team, I have had no fix to the constant Error 500, disconnecting from host. According to the support staff I spoke to, they are now "Investigating on their end" and telling me it could be a possible issue with my ISP blocking the game. Here's a list of troubleshooting steps I found / or was informed to try:

    Disabling Background applications, Unplugging modem 5+ min, uninstalling/reinstalling game, Verify and Repair, Windows and Nvidia Updates, Flushing DNS, Renewing Ipconfig, releasing ipconfig, Repairing EAC, Signing in and out of Xbox PC app, Changing to static and/or dynamic DNS server address, fresh install of windows, reinstalling DirectX, Uninstalling and reinstalling Microsoft Visual C++ programs 2010-2019. Maybe some of these will work for you, but I recommend getting in contact with support before you attempt anything too complex. It's possible your situation could be different than mine. Good Luck.
